Summary:

This position is responsible for leading the discovery, design, integration, and implementation of Workday Procurement ERP software while creating risk-mitigating strategies during the transition from the legacy ERP System Peoplesoft on behalf of the Procurement Services Department. The Procurement Systems Analyst position is also responsible for working cross-functionally to identify areas for improvement and develop solutions that will optimize all software systems utilized by the Procurement Department to deliver projects on time and efficiently on behalf of customer departments. This role operates and enhances ERP applications supporting NTTA’s Procurements within Workday ERP system.

In a post-Workday implementation environment, the Procurement Systems Analyst will transition into a systems admin role for all Procurement systems and operate as the primary interface with the Director of Procurement on all data reporting and key performance indicator reporting for Procurement Services. The Procurement Systems Analyst will be the primary point of contact for any software system Procurement utilized through third-party vendors that includes system updates, managing the software vendor relationships, training internal and external stakeholders, and communicating changes to the entire organization

Responsibilities:

  • Work with departmental subject matter experts to ensure that ERP testing scenarios are created and executed for all Workday configuration updates.
  • Sound ERP understanding that can be applied in high-level process conversations and granular configuration discussions.
  • Consistently seeks and finds process or technical inefficiencies and openly advises the Procurement Services on possible enhancements.
  • Develop and conduct training that effectively summarizes themes from the technical responsibilities into messaging the entire organization can leverage.
  • Analyzing the business needs of stakeholders to recommend the appropriate application or design to address those needs.
  • Provides deep analytical support in procurement projects, including but not limited to, the implementation of procurement systems and project tracking tools.
  • Ensuring thorough documentation of requirements, conceptual design, and end-to-end processes
  • Perform various systems tasks, including extracting data and creating management reports, and working with internal stakeholders to improve efficiencies and effectiveness.
  • Applies established procedures, policies, and standards with little or no supervisory guidance.
  • Performs project management tasks as assigned.
  • Conducts analysis utilized by the Director of Procurement for sourcing and operational purposes including cost and pricing analysis.


Qualifications:

Minimum:

  • Bachelor’s degree.
  • Five years of experience in ERP implementation.
  • Comprehensive industry knowledge of ERP systems specific to financial data, reporting, and procure to pay – (PeopleSoft, Oracle, and Workday ERP systems).
  • Ability to collaborate with and advise functional stakeholders, end users, and leads on configurations and solutions within Workday Financial Systems.
  • Highly detail-oriented with excellent time management, prioritization, and organizational skills.
  • Business area knowledge with an understanding of financial processes and data.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ication, presentation, and informal communication skills.
  • Preferred:

    • Bachelor’s degree in information systems, computer science, or supply chain management.
    • Five years of experience as a lead analyst managing Workday Financial Systems and Procure to Pay – preferably in Government or Transportation.
    • Proficiency in analyzing data using business intelligence tools in Workday and assessing that data using Tableau, Excel, or a preferred data platform.
    • Cloud ERP implementation experience.
    • Proven driver of projects during the design, build, implementation, and stabilization phases.
  • About NTTA: NTTA is a political subdivision of Texas created to acquire, construct, maintain and operate toll roads in North Texas. As a customer-driven organization, NTTA delivers a safe and reliable toll system for millions of customers each year in one of the fastest growing regions in the United States.
